Body Care

Palmers lotion + coconut oil= match made in heaven! Made with a high concentration of natural ingredients, this aims to provide up to 24 hours moisture and whilst I haven’t worn this for that long, it really does make my skin look instantly amazing and well nourished. It is absorbed incredibly fast making applying body lotion an actually doable task in the winter. Coconut oil deeply moisturises and softens, monoi oil hydrates and sweet almost oil soothes the skin; all essential to keep the skin looking healthy and radiant. And if that wasn't enough, this has no parabens, phthalates, mineral oil, gluten, sulphates or dyes. Must have!

Haircare

Currently on offer at Boots, this is a product I always go back to (mostly because my mum uses up all of it and I need to keep repurchasing). Given we both have coloured hair, it is no surprise that our ends can turn bristle and dry, enter this magic hair oil. Claiming to provide shine, moisture and softness, I can certainly vouch for all of these things. I usually apply it before and after blowdrying as a finishing touch and the result is smooth, silky hair and without any flyaways. This is versatile, non-greasy and all-round champ hair oil.
